Centro Region temperatures in July

Centro Region is a region in Portugal. July in has maximum daytime temperatures ranging from pleasant in Cabo Carvoeiro with 22°C to very high temperatures in Monfortinho with 34°C. Nighttime temperatures generally drop to 19°C in Monfortinho and 18°C in Cabo Carvoeiro.

  • What is the warmest city in July in Centro Region?
  • Based on our systematic data collection, Monfortinho has been identified as the city with the highest average temperatures. The daytime temperature usually hovers around 34°C, while at night is goes down to an approximate temperature of 19°C."

  • What is the coldest city in July in Centro Region?
  • For the month of July, Cabo Carvoeiro is the most temperate city in Centro Region based on our records. With highs averaging 22°C and nighttime temperatures dipping to around 18°C.

  • How much sun does Centro Region get in July?
  • The weather is predominantly sunny, with an estimated total of around 385 hours of sunshine in Ericeira. This means many sunny days, which creates a cheerful atmosphere during this month.
